Question

If '+' means '-', '-' means '+', '÷' means '×' and '×' means '÷', then,
18 × 3 ÷ 4 - 5 + 3 = ?

A.

29

B.

21

C.

26

D.

31

Correct option is C

18 × 3 ÷ 4 - 5 + 3 = ?
As per the question
18 ÷ 3 × 4 + 5 – 3
= 6 × 4 + 5 – 3
= 24 +5 -3
= 26
